在Microsoft Excel中声明一个变量

时间:2018-02-17 19:37:09

标签: excel

可以在excel中声明一个变量,假设N = 10,那么如果我在单元格中键入字母N并且该单元格成为一个总和的一部分,那么该单元格将被计为10?

2 个答案:

答案 0 :(得分:1)

转到公式> 定义名称定义您的变量。

然后使用 Alt + F11 打开VBA 插入模块并使用此功能:

Function EVAL(rng As Range) As Variant
    EVAL = Evaluate(rng.Value)
End Function

您可以在公式中使用该功能:=EVAL(Cell where is your var N)

答案 1 :(得分:0)

您可以命名单元格,选择它,点击带有地址的字段(位于左上角)并输入名称(在您的示例中为" N")。此单元格中的值是变量的值。好主意是制作包含变量的单独表格(你可以避免混乱),但这不是必需的。

然后你可以在公式中使用它,例如:=A1*N。但请记住,如果您只想使用其值填充单元格,请使用=N代替N